Working with Excel, especially for those who handle large datasets or complex spreadsheets, often requires more than the basic functionality the program offers. This is where Visual Basic for Applications (VBA) comes into play, allowing users to create and automate tasks, including interacting with worksheet names. The ability to read worksheet names is crucial for various tasks, such as report generation, data consolidation, and automation of repetitive tasks.
For Excel users who are familiar with VBA, reading worksheet names is a fundamental skill that can significantly enhance their workflow. It enables them to dynamically reference worksheets, reducing the need for manual updates when worksheet names change. This feature is particularly useful in workbooks where worksheets are frequently added, removed, or renamed. By leveraging VBA to read worksheet names, users can create more flexible and maintainable Excel applications.
How To Get Sheet Name Using VBA With Example
Understanding VBA and Worksheet Names
Understanding how VBA interacts with worksheet names is the first step to leveraging this powerful feature. Essentially, VBA allows you to loop through all worksheets in a workbook, read their names, and perform actions based on those names. This can be achieved through various methods, including using the Worksheets collection or the Sheet object. By mastering this aspect of VBA, developers can create sophisticated Excel tools that adapt to changing worksheet environments.
Excel How To Get All Sheets Names And Its Specific Cell Value Using Macro Vba Stack Overflow
Practical Applications of Reading Worksheet Names
The practical applications of reading worksheet names in VBA are vast and varied. For instance, a common scenario involves generating reports that need to include data from multiple worksheets. By using VBA to read worksheet names, you can dynamically adjust your report to include all relevant worksheets, even if they are added or removed after the initial setup. This capability also facilitates the automation of tasks that would otherwise require manual intervention, such as formatting new worksheets according to a standard template.
Troubleshooting Common Issues with VBA Worksheet Name Reading
Despite the power and flexibility that reading worksheet names offers, users may encounter several common issues when implementing this functionality in VBA. One of the most frequent challenges is handling worksheets that are very similar in name, which can lead to errors if not properly distinguished. Another issue arises when dealing with worksheets that are protected or hidden, as these may require special handling to access their names. By being aware of these potential pitfalls and knowing how to address them, developers can ensure that their VBA applications are robust and reliable.
Excel Excel VBA Prevent Changing The WorkSheet Name
In conclusion, the ability to read worksheet names in VBA is a valuable skill for any Excel user looking to automate tasks and enhance their workflow. Whether you’re dealing with complex data analysis, report generation, or simply looking to streamline your Excel usage, mastering this aspect of VBA can significantly impact your productivity. With practice and experience, you’ll be able to unlock the full potential of Excel and tackle even the most challenging tasks with ease.
Excel Why The Vba Code Is Not Matching The Sheet Name When The Names Exactly Line Up Stack Overflow
Excel Why The Vba Code Is Not Matching The Sheet Name When The Names Exactly Line Up Stack Overflow




